As an Aftersales Supply Planning Specialist, you will be responsible for ensuring stable, timely, and customer focused supply of Aftersales parts to the global retailer network. The role plays a critical part in minimising vehicle downtime, protecting the customer experience, and supporting overall Aftersales performance. You will also be responsible for communicating with key internal stakeholders on parts supply statuses and tracking progress of projects and critical activities that impact Aftersales parts supply and effective reporting on operational performance and projects.

What You'll Do

  • Customer Focus
    • Monitor retailer backorders daily with a primary focus on Buy Back and Vehicle Off Road cases, ensuring supply risks are identified and addressed at the earliest opportunity.
    • Actively investigate and assess alternative supply source options to mitigate risk and reduce customer impact.
    • Maintain clear prioritisation of parts supply based on customer impact and business criticality.
  • Supply Planning and Performance Management
    • Manage supply performance for assigned suppliers or product groups, ensuring agreed service levels are achieved.
    • Identify potential or actual supply constraints early and implement mitigation actions ahead of customer impact.
    • Lead supplier escalation activities and recovery plans for critical shortages, working closely with our Logistics provider and Production.
    • Coordinate parts availability for Aftersales campaigns and new initiatives, ensuring readiness to support launch activity.
  • Stakeholder Communication and Supply Visibility
    • Provide clear, timely, and accurate updates on backorders, supply status, risks, and recovery timelines to internal stakeholders.
    • Act as a primary point of contact for supply related queries within assigned product areas.
    • Maintain alignment between supply planning priorities and regional customer needs through structured communication.
    • Support customer facing teams with clear information to enable effective customer management.
  • Reporting and Insight
    • Prepare Aftersales supply reports and key performance indicators.
    • Investigate deviations from agreed standards and translate data into clear insights and actions.
    • Highlight risks, trends, and recurring issues to support decision making and prioritisation.
    • Recommend process or planning improvements to strengthen supply stability and customer outcomes.
